New Online Transactional Platform, EEZE, Sets out to Combat Fraud in Second-Hand, Private-Party Auto Sales Zainal Abidin, 18/01/2026 MONTREAL, March 19, 2024–(BUSINESS WIRE)–EEZE, a new transactional platform dedicated to safeguarding peer-to-peer auto sales, officially launches today, serving the Ontario and Quebec markets. Designed to combat fraud and uncertainty in private-party transactions, EEZE offers a comprehensive suite of services to verify individuals, vehicles, and facilitate secure money transfers.As online marketplace fraud increases, buyers face uncertainty when dealing with unfamiliar sellers in private sales, particularly in the used car market. Even well-known platforms such as Kijiji, Autotrader and Facebook Marketplace are susceptible to fraud. EEZE steps in to fill this gap, providing a secure and reliable environment for buyers and sellers to conduct transactions with peace of mind.“At EEZE, we’re on a mission to de-risk private-party transactions by introducing trust, guarantee, and financing options,” says Tave Della Porta, co-founder of EEZE. “Our platform is designed to complement online marketplaces by addressing the challenges faced by both buyers and sellers in navigating the complexities of peer-to-peer auto sales.”EEZE verifies individuals by confirming their identity through rigorous screening processes that protect both parties from fraudulent activity. Motorists favor used cars due to budget constraints Zainal Abidin, 16/01/2026 When buying a second hand car in 2024, 58% of consumers’ primary motivation would be saving money, according to The Motor Ombudsman’s Opinion Matters poll of 2,050 motorists.Rather than buying a brand new equivalent, budgets and household bills would influence consumers to buy a used car.Bill Fennell, chief ombudsman and md at The Motor Ombudsman said: “Several million used cars change hands each year, and the second hand market, for some consumers, provides a more affordable and accessible proposition.”Four in ten respondents stated they would prefer buying a car that was previously owned by at least one person prior to avoiding the initial loss in value associated with buying a new car. In addition, 20% would hope to avoid waiting for their vehicle to be built and delivered.Showroom visits are important to one in four buyers. How Volvo got customers to accept Ferrari-like wait times Zainal Abidin, 12/01/2026 “When I started at Volvo it was written in stone that if you ordered a car in three months you got your car,” Zurhausen, who is head of online business at Volvo Germany, told Automotive News Europe.Today, a customer often has to wait longer than 90 days.For example, because of software issues it will take almost two years for some customers of the EX90 flagship electric large SUV to take delivery. Is Rivian Stock A Buy Or A Sell After Unveiling The R2 And R3 Product Line? Zainal Abidin, 10/01/2026 Rivian Automotive (RIVN) is looking to challenge Tesla (TSLA), Ford (F) and General Motors (GM) with its adventure-styled electric vehicles. RIVN shares surged 40% in December 2023 but have come back to earth to begin 2024, falling more than 50%. X Rivian stock was handed a price hike on March 15 after shares jumped nearly 13% on positive sentiment around the EV startup’s R2 and R3 vehicle reveal event. However, questions remain whether the company can bring its new product line to market without help amid waning EV demand.UBS raised its price target on Rivian stock to 9, up from its previous 8. However, UBS maintained a sell rating on the shares. The firm noted that after the company’s March 7 product launch the “narrative around Rivian has changed.”UBS added that revealing new products diverts attention from weaker demand for the older R1 vehicle line and that Rivian’s decision to pause construction on its new Georgia plant extends its cash runway. Thar: Mahindra Experiences About 40 Percent Growth In Car Sales For February 2024 Zainal Abidin, 09/01/2026 Mahindra Experiences About 40 Percent Growth In Car Sales For February 2024Indian automaker Mahindra has released its sales report for February 2024. Last month the company managed to sell over 42 thousand units of passenger vehicles, which is approximately an increase of about 40 percent in comparison to monthly sales of last year. With each passing month Mahindra is closing in on the gap in monthly sales chart with Tata Motors in the Indian market. The continuous rise in demand for SUVs can help Mahindra to secure the third position in the sales chart, also recently Mahindra had announced that it is increasing its production capacity to cater to the pent up demand.In February 2024, Mahindra managed to sell a total of 42,401 units of passenger vehicles. This figure includes products sold in the domestic market. This indicates a year on year increase in sales by 12,043 units which translates to 39.66 percent year-on-year increase in domestic sales. The sales figures for total passenger vehicles sold by Mahindra for February 2023 stood at 30,358 units.The year to date passenger vehicles sold by Mahindra in the domestic market this financial year till February 2024 is 4,19,246 units.
